The cryptocurrency market is facing yet another bearish momentum, with most digital assets losing over 2% in the past day alone. Dogecoin ($DOGE), the popular meme coin, has been hit especially hard, dropping by more than 6% within the last 24 hours. As the market sentiment remains gloomy, traders and investors are left wondering: where is Dogecoin headed next? Why is Dogecoin’s Price Down? Several factors have contributed to the decline in Dogecoin’s price, all tied to broader market forces and macroeconomic events: Weak US Data and Rising Trade War Tensions: Ongoing geopolitical tensions, fueled by President Donald Trump’s aggressive stance on import taxes targeting countries like Canada and parts of Europe, are rattling global markets and sparking concerns about economic instability, prompting investors to liquidate their crypto holdings in favor of safer assets. Heavy Sell-Off Across the Crypto Market: The bearish sentiment has led to a broad sell-off in the market, impacting major and minor cryptocurrencies alike. Dogecoin, being a meme coin with less inherent utility compared to some other tokens, has suffered more significantly in this environment.
